What Is Asbestos Siding?

Asbestos siding is a construction material made by mixing cement with asbestos fibers. The asbestos fibers strengthened the cement and made the siding more resistant to fire, moisture, insects, and weather damage.

Manufacturers widely produced asbestos cement siding from the 1920s through the 1970s. It became popular because it was:

  • Fire-resistant
  • Durable
  • Affordable
  • Low maintenance
  • Resistant to rot and insects
  • Good for insulation

The siding was commonly manufactured in shingles, panels, or boards that resembled wood or slate. Many older homes still have these materials installed on their exterior walls.

Although asbestos siding can remain stable for decades, aging, weathering, and renovation activities can cause the material to deteriorate over time.

How to Identify Asbestos Siding

Identifying asbestos siding can be difficult because many modern materials look similar. However, there are several clues homeowners can examine.

Common Characteristics of Asbestos Siding

1. Age of the Home

Homes built between the 1920s and late 1970s are more likely to contain asbestos siding.

2. Cement-Like Texture

Asbestos siding usually feels hard and brittle like concrete.

3. Shingle Appearance

It often appears in small shingles or rectangular panels.

4. Patterned Surface

Many asbestos shingles have wood-grain patterns or textured finishes.

5. Color and Aging

Older asbestos siding may appear faded, chalky, or cracked over time.

6. Manufacturer Markings

Sometimes the back of shingles contains manufacturer stamps or codes.

Is Asbestos Siding Dangerous?

One of the most common questions homeowners ask is whether asbestos siding is dangerous.

The answer depends largely on the condition of the material.

When Asbestos Siding Is Less Dangerous

Asbestos siding is generally considered lower risk when:

  • It is intact
  • It is sealed or painted
  • It is not disturbed
  • It is in good condition

Undamaged asbestos cement products release very few fibers into the air.

When It Becomes Dangerous

The danger increases significantly when the siding is:

  • Broken
  • Cracked
  • Drilled
  • Sanded
  • Sawed
  • Removed improperly
  • Damaged by storms or renovations

When disturbed, microscopic asbestos fibers can become airborne and enter the lungs.

Health Risks of Asbestos Exposure

Asbestos exposure can lead to serious illnesses, especially after long-term or repeated exposure.

Major Health Conditions Linked to Asbestos

Asbestosis

A chronic lung disease caused by inhaling asbestos fibers.

Lung Cancer

Exposure significantly increases the risk of lung cancer.

Mesothelioma

A rare but aggressive cancer affecting the lining of the lungs or abdomen.

Pleural Disease

Asbestos can cause thickening or scarring of lung tissue.

Symptoms may take decades to appear after exposure.

How Professionals Test for Asbestos

The only reliable way to confirm asbestos is through laboratory testing.

Professional Inspection Process

Visual Assessment

Inspectors examine the siding condition and age.

Sample Collection

Small material samples are carefully removed.

Laboratory Analysis

Certified labs analyze the samples under microscopes.

Report Preparation

The inspector provides findings and recommendations.

Homeowners should avoid collecting samples themselves because disturbing the siding can release fibers.

Asbestos Siding Removal Process

If removal becomes necessary, licensed professionals follow strict safety procedures.

Typical Removal Steps

1. Site Preparation

Workers isolate the work area and use protective barriers.

2. Protective Equipment

Technicians wear respirators and protective suits.

3. Wet Removal Methods

The siding is sprayed with water to reduce airborne dust.

4. Careful Detachment

Panels are removed intact whenever possible.

5. Secure Packaging

Materials are sealed in approved disposal bags.

6. Disposal

Waste is transported to licensed hazardous disposal facilities.

7. Final Cleanup

The site is cleaned and inspected thoroughly.

Improper removal can spread asbestos contamination throughout a property.

Can You Paint Asbestos Siding?

Yes, painting asbestos siding is often recommended if the material is intact.

Painting can help:

  • Seal the surface
  • Reduce weather damage
  • Improve appearance
  • Minimize fiber release

Best Practices for Painting

  • Clean gently without pressure washing
  • Avoid scraping aggressively
  • Use high-quality exterior paint
  • Repair damaged sections first

Never sand asbestos siding before painting.

Common Myths About Asbestos Siding

There are many misconceptions about asbestos siding.

Myth 1: All Asbestos Siding Must Be Removed

Not always. Stable siding may remain safely in place.

Myth 2: You Can Identify Asbestos Just by Looking

Laboratory testing is the only reliable method.

Myth 3: Brief Exposure Always Causes Illness

Health risks usually increase with prolonged or repeated exposure.

Myth 4: Painting Makes It Completely Safe

Painting helps but does not eliminate asbestos.

Myth 5: Modern Homes Contain Asbestos

Most modern construction materials no longer use asbestos.

Professional Abatement vs Encapsulation

Understanding the difference between these two approaches helps homeowners make informed decisions.

Abatement

Abatement usually refers to full removal and disposal.

Advantages

  • Eliminates asbestos from the property
  • Improves future renovation flexibility

Disadvantages

  • Higher cost
  • Greater disturbance during removal

Encapsulation

Encapsulation seals the material in place.

Advantages

  • Lower cost
  • Reduced fiber release risk
  • Faster process

Disadvantages

  • Asbestos remains present
  • Future monitoring still required
